    The set-up is straightforward: the key's primary role is to rotate the cylinder for unlocking. Yes, that's it! But don’t let the simplicity fool you; this function is both vital and fascinating. When you insert a correctly shaped key into the lock, it engages with the internal components in a way that allows the cylinder to turn. Just picture it: the shape and cuts of the key are specifically designed to fit snugly within the lock’s mechanism. 

    Now, here’s where it gets interesting: as you turn the key, you're not just performing a mechanical action; you're triggering a series of movements inside the lock. The turn rotates the cylinder, which in turn engages the locking mechanism. Voila! The lock either springs open or secures itself—all thanks to that little metal gadget you casually carry on your keyring. Can you imagine if keys couldn’t turn the cylinder?     In locksmithing, precision is paramount. Each key is crafted with unique grooves and notches that correspond to specific locks. That's why your home key won’t work in your car—different locks, different codes!
